| Description | Letter to George Gordon, care of Ann Gordon, Fochabers, from George Cruickshank, Edinburgh, regarding his own ague, hoping that Gordon’s trunks have arrived, query over accounts, with another letter added on the paper signed ?A.G., implying that the business with the accounts grew out of some animosity against Gordon, 22 October 1766 |
